Palmeiras lost to Flamengo in the final of the Libertadores and could see the Rubro-Negro lift the Brasileirão trophy this Wednesday (03). The Verdão, however, still dreams of lifting the cup, but will have four important absences against Atlético-MG.
For the match against Atlético-MG, Palmeiras will be without Felipe Anderson, who left the game against Flamengo in the Libertadores due to pain. On Monday (01), the player underwent tests and was diagnosed with a sprained ankle.
In addition, Palmeiras will not be able to count on the suspended Giay, Aníbal Moreno, and Facundo Torres. In other words, Abel Ferreira’s team has four absences for the clash this Wednesday (03) against Atlético-MG at Arena MRV.
It’s worth remembering that Flamengo needs a win or two draws in the last two rounds of the Campeonato Brasileiro. Therefore, the probability of the Rubro-Negro winning the most important trophy in Brazil is extremely high!
Currently, Flamengo is in first place on the Campeonato Brasileiro table with 75 points. Palmeiras, therefore, is in second place with 70. In other words, the Most Beloved has five more than the runner-up of the Libertadores.
The match between Flamengo and Ceará is scheduled for 9:30 p.m. (Brasília time) this Wednesday (03), at Maracanã. The clash, it’s worth noting, is valid for the 37th round of the Campeonato Brasileiro.
